That code isn't the new update... but parts of it... the new code coming tonight parses and builds channels faster... and also does this with "Find Missing" enabled... but not first run... "Find Missing" still can be slow for two runs, but gets faster and faster each run as the cache builds... if you leave it enabled, by the third or fourth PTVL run it will have decent speed. But never as fast as disabling it....

There is a drawback... disabling "find missing" will really kills a lot of my features... because it's function is to find missing artwork and missing guide data... So if you like artwork for plugins and livetv leave it enabled.
